Loading...
Searching...
No Matches
Public Types | Public Attributes | List of all members
ConfSVG Struct Reference
Collaboration diagram for ConfSVG:
Collaboration graph
[legend]

Public Types

typedef drain::EnumFlagger< drain::MultiFlagger< FileSVG::IncludePolicy > > IncludeFlagger
 
typedef drain::EnumFlagger< drain::MultiFlagger< FileSVG::PathPolicy > > PathPolicyFlagger
 SVG file may contain several "modules", for example rows or columns of IMAGE:s. This is the name of the current module, contained in a GROUP.
 

Public Attributes

IncludeFlagger svgIncludes
 
PathPolicyFlagger pathPolicyFlagger = FileSVG::ABSOLUTE
 
std::string pathPolicy = "ABSOLUTE"
 
std::string mainTitle = "AUTO"
 
std::string groupIdentifier = ""
 
std::string groupTitle = "AUTO"
 
drain::UniTuple< double, 3 > fontSizes = {15.0, 12.0, 10.0}
 
drain::UniTuple< double, 3 > boxHeights = {30.0, 25.0, 15.0}
 
int debug = 0
 

Member Data Documentation

◆ boxHeights

drain::UniTuple<double,3> boxHeights = {30.0, 25.0, 15.0}

0 - mainTitle 1 - groupTitle

◆ fontSizes

drain::UniTuple<double,3> fontSizes = {15.0, 12.0, 10.0}

0 - mainTitle.main 1 - mainTitle.second and groupTile.main 2 - groupTitle.second 3 - imageTitle


The documentation for this struct was generated from the following file: